Rafael Nadal’s comeback could happen soon.

Hope for fans of Spanish tennis star Rafael Nadal (36). Toni Nadal (62), uncle of the Roland Garros record winner, indicated on Spanish television RTVE that the comeback of the sand specialist could be imminent. “Rafael is on the right track. I think it won’t be long before he can compete again,” said Rafa’s regular sponsor.

With regard to the French Open, however, the fans should not have too high expectations that Nadal will compete without proper preparation, “we don’t have to kid ourselves”. The great thing is that the 22-time Grand Slam winner is always dangerous in the second week of every Grand Slam. Toni Nadal is cautiously optimistic: “With a bit of luck in the draw in the first round, anything can happen later on.”

That sounds like a warning to the competition. Because a battered Nadal is always dangerous in Paris. A year ago, the Spaniard was only able to participate due to a foot injury thanks to numerous anesthetic injections and anti-inflammatory drugs. Finally he defeated the Norwegian Casper Ruud 6:3, 6:3, 6:0 in the final and celebrated his 14th victory at the French Open.

Nadal has been struggling with a hip injury since the Australian Open in January. As a result, the Spaniard had to cancel several tournaments, including the starting tournaments in the sand season. It is unclear when the tennis star will return. But he certainly won’t let his favorite tournament in Paris be taken away from him. (nsa)
